Episode description

Based on Luke 15:17–24 ‘Never far away from the Father’s Heart’ is a reflection on one of the most beautiful father-child relationship narratives in the Bible, it tells of the deep intrinsic human relationship that is beyond compression, it is an emotional story of what it means to love someone regardless of their shortcomings and misgivings, above all it is a reflection on what constitutes the agape love. Although story is commonly called the prodigal son, but today, I would like to spin it a little, away from that narrative because the focus and I believe the importance and the lesson of the story rest not on the extravagance of the character but in his action and that of the father.
